Abstract
Parallel chain system for the structure of β-chitin is studied from a stereochemical point of view and the structure has been refined by least squares procedures. As a first step correct atomic positions representing standard configuration of glucopyranose ring, peptide unit and CH
OH group have been redetermined in the unit cell. The unit cell is monoclinic with dimensions a = 4.85 Å, b = 10.38 Å (fibre axis), c = 9.26 Å and β = 97.5°. The space group is P2
. The refinement has been done using five geometrical parameters, temperatur factor and the scaling factor. The R and Ø-value are found to be 0.235 and 37.61, respectively. The refined structure is found to be free from all short contacts. The refined chains form interhydrogen bond of the type N - H · · · O
